Brand Manager - Dubarry of Ireland in Chipping Norton
Brand Manager - Dubarry of Ireland

Brand Manager - Dubarry of Ireland in Chipping Norton

Chipping Norton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
G

At a Glance

  • Tasks: Lead brand strategy and multi-channel campaigns for a heritage lifestyle brand.
  • Company: Dubarry of Ireland, a renowned Irish company with a proud heritage since 1937.
  • Benefits: Competitive salary, creative freedom, and the chance to shape a global brand.
  • Why this job: Join a passionate team and make a real impact on a beloved brand's future.
  • Qualifications: Experience in brand management, creativity, and strong communication skills.
  • Other info: Based in the beautiful Cotswolds with excellent career growth opportunities.

The predicted salary is between 36000 - 60000 £ per year.

Are you ready to take a leadership role with a heritage lifestyle brand in shaping and guiding its future across global apparel markets? Established in 1937, Dubarry is a renowned Irish company with a long and proud heritage, currently seeking a safe and experienced pair of hands with the vision and creativity to manage a multi-channel brand across wholesale, online, own retail and event marketing. As Brand Manager, you will ensure consistency, quality and emotional resonance across all key consumer touchpoints. You will lead brand strategy and campaign execution, combining creative vision with commercial awareness to drive growth and long-term brand equity. Based out of our UK offices near Chipping Norton in the Cotswolds you will report directly to the Marketing Director in our Irish HQ.

The Role

  • Brand Strategy & Campaign Leadership
    • Lead bi-annual, multi-channel brand campaigns from concept through to execution and evaluation.
    • Act as brand guardian, ensuring consistency, quality and tone across all consumer touch-points by managing brand calendars and campaign planning.
  • Creative Direction & Content
    • Set creative direction across photography, videography, print, digital, email and social.
    • Lead photoshoots, from concept and mood boards to final execution and logistics.
    • Art Direction for photography & videography across these photoshoots including location sourcing, model selection, outfit and prop styling.
    • Sign off all creative assets, ensuring adherence to brand standards throughout.
  • Digital, Social & E-commerce
    • Own and manage the annual social media strategy.
    • Oversee content planning, calendars, community management and performance.
    • Collaborate with the e-commerce team on website creative and digital performance activity.
  • PR, Influencer & Event Marketing
    • Lead press activity and work closely with the PR agency on brand activations and events.
    • Identify and manage relationships with brand-aligned influencers and ambassadors.
    • Represent Dubarry at key events, overseeing content capture.
  • Commercial & Performance Management
    • Own brand marketing budgets and manage spend across key projects.
    • Execution of bi-annual catalogues from concept, pagination and design to proofing, quotations and final sign off.
    • Set KPIs for campaigns and analyse performance to inform future strategy.
    • Managing B2B client relationships while working closely with internal sales teams and their key wholesale accounts.

Next Steps: Forward cover letter outlining your suitability for this position and your CV to Ciara at ciara@ghrconsulting.ie

Brand Manager - Dubarry of Ireland in Chipping Norton employer: GHR Consulting

Dubarry of Ireland is an exceptional employer that offers a dynamic work environment steeped in heritage and creativity. Located in the picturesque Cotswolds, employees benefit from a supportive culture that fosters professional growth and innovation, alongside opportunities to lead impactful brand strategies across global markets. With a commitment to quality and emotional resonance in all consumer touchpoints, Dubarry empowers its team members to thrive in their roles while contributing to the legacy of a beloved lifestyle brand.
G

Contact Detail:

GHR Consulting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Brand Manager - Dubarry of Ireland in Chipping Norton

✨Tip Number 1

Network like a pro! Reach out to people in the industry, attend events, and connect with potential colleagues on LinkedIn. We all know that sometimes it’s not just what you know, but who you know that can help you land that dream job.

✨Tip Number 2

Show off your creativity! When you get the chance to meet with hiring managers or during interviews, bring along a portfolio of your past work. We want to see how you’ve led campaigns and brought brands to life – visuals speak louder than words!

✨Tip Number 3

Be prepared to discuss your vision! As a Brand Manager, you’ll need to articulate your ideas clearly. Think about how you would approach brand strategy and campaign execution for Dubarry, and be ready to share your thoughts during interviews.

✨Tip Number 4

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in being part of the Dubarry team. Let’s make it happen together!

We think you need these skills to ace Brand Manager - Dubarry of Ireland in Chipping Norton

Brand Strategy
Campaign Leadership
Creative Direction
Content Management
Digital Marketing
Social Media Strategy
E-commerce Collaboration
Public Relations
Influencer Management
Event Marketing
Budget Management
Performance Analysis
B2B Client Relationship Management
Project Management

Some tips for your application 🫡

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Make sure to highlight your relevant experience and how it aligns with Dubarry's brand values. Show us your passion for the heritage lifestyle sector and why you’re the perfect fit for this role.

Tailor Your CV: Don’t just send a generic CV! Tailor it to showcase your skills in brand strategy, campaign leadership, and creative direction. Use keywords from the job description to make it clear that you understand what we’re looking for.

Showcase Your Creative Side: As a Brand Manager, creativity is key! Include examples of past campaigns or projects you've led, especially those that demonstrate your ability to manage multi-channel strategies. Visuals can be a great addition if they’re relevant!

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ss any important updates. Plus, it shows you’re keen on joining the Dubarry team!

How to prepare for a job interview at GHR Consulting

✨Know the Brand Inside Out

Before your interview, dive deep into Dubarry's history, values, and product offerings. Understand their brand ethos and how they position themselves in the market. This knowledge will help you demonstrate your passion for the brand and show that you're the right fit for leading their marketing strategy.

✨Showcase Your Creative Vision

Prepare to discuss your previous experiences with brand campaigns and creative direction. Bring examples of your work, such as mood boards or campaign results, to illustrate your ability to lead multi-channel strategies. This will highlight your creativity and commercial awareness, which are crucial for the role.

✨Be Ready to Discuss Metrics

As a Brand Manager, you'll need to manage budgets and analyse campaign performance. Be prepared to talk about how you've set KPIs in the past and the impact of your strategies on brand growth. This shows that you can combine creativity with analytical skills, which is key for driving long-term brand equity.

✨Engage with Questions

At the end of the interview, don’t shy away from asking insightful questions. Inquire about the company's future direction, upcoming campaigns, or how they measure success. This not only shows your interest but also gives you a chance to assess if Dubarry aligns with your career goals.

Brand Manager - Dubarry of Ireland in Chipping Norton
GHR Consulting
Location: Chipping Norton
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

G
  • Brand Manager - Dubarry of Ireland in Chipping Norton

    Chipping Norton
    Full-Time
    36000 - 60000 £ / year (est.)
  • G

    GHR Consulting

    50-100
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>